Warning Signs You Need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ore the following warning signs: musty odors that won’t go away.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your property, it may be a sign of hidden water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and address any potential issues. Don’t wait until the smell spreads.
Visible Water Stains
If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s a clear s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the stain and address any potential issues. Don’t ignore the warning signs.
Buckled or Warped Flooring
If your flooring is buckled or warped, it may be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and address any potential problems. Don’t wait until the damage spreads.
Rust or Mineral Deposits
If you notice rust or mineral deposits on your property’s surfaces, it may be a sign of hidden water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and address any potential problems. Don’t ignore the warning signs.

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Cost in Olympia, SC
The cost of Rental Property Water Damage Restoration in Olympia, SC can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ates and works with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. Get a free estimate today.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of containment |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of drying equ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ning equipment needed |
| Restoration and Repairs |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area and type of repairs needed |
